WebOf these, PTU and MMI/CMZ are most commonly used. Previous studies have suggested a greater risk of adverse reactions with PTU than MMI/CMZ during treatment for hyperthyroidism (5,6). However, the studies listed in the 2016 edition of the American Thyroid Association guidelines showed a similar risk of adverse events for both drugs (7). WebApr 26, 2024 · The side-effects that most commonly occur are: Rash. Pruritus (itching) Mild stomach upset. Headache. Painful joints. The above side-effects are usually not serious and often go, even if you continue with the medication. A rare but serious side-effect is an effect on the blood-making cells.
